Salem : is a city of northeast Massachusetts northeast of Boston. It was founded in 1626. It gained notoriety as the site of witchcraft trials (1692) and of Nathaniel Hawthorne's House of the Seven Gables.

In 1187, Jerusalem was captured by the Saracens and in May 1291, the remnants of the Christian armies were finally driven from Acre, the last stronghold of the Crusaders in the Holy Land.

There are two Talmuds: the Jerusalem (or Palestinian) Talmud which was originated in Erez Israel around 300 AD, and the Babylonian Talmud which was completed about 600 AD.

In the seventeenth sura of the Koran it is written that upon a certain night Mohammed was transported from the temple at Mecca to that of Jerusalem, but no details are given of the strange journey.
